Output 68aeedfb745b6a7d79898ad95c33db821ba5968ce56efc4a969ae4fec3ef27f6:1

value
50936542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b4f15a44a3f6e6f8dfd03ff3a7e34d28cecbf52 OP_EQUALVERIFY OP_CHECKSIG
address
13VPz52fnmnhE9MmnXT4qELXetH233PFXD
transaction
68aeedfb745b6a7d79898ad95c33db821ba5968ce56efc4a969ae4fec3ef27f6
confirmations
66
spent
true